The CV4015/6065 is an indirectly heated RF and IF vari-μ pentode for use in compact radio equipment subject to vibration. It is a special quality version of the EF92 design. Vibration resistance is achieved by the use of double mica sheets in the supports.
The KQDD/K identifies this valve as being made to specification K1001 or K1006, the QDD denotes the qualification authority (Unknown) and the K identifies the maker as ETEL, Electronic Tubes, High Wycombe.
Through the outer bright screen can be glimpsed the wire grids. The double mica discs are clear to see.
The thin glass tube envelope is 18 mm in diameter and, excluding the B7G base pins, is 45 mm tall.
References: Data-sheet & 6065 data-sheet. Type CV4015 was first introduced in 1953. See also 1953 adverts.
